played in his first <strong>NHL</strong> season appearing in 57games with Calgary … was the Flames nominee for the Masterton Trophy - the youngest nominee in history … won the Scurfield Humanitarian Award asthe Flames player who best exemplifies the qualities of perseverance, determination and leadership on the ice <strong>com</strong>bined with dedication to <strong>com</strong>munityservice … led Flames rookies in goals (5) ... recorded his first <strong>NHL</strong> career MP game on Feb. 25 vs. Phoenix (2a) ... returned to the line-up on Feb. 9 aftermissing 11 games due to injury ... scored his first <strong>NHL</strong> career goal on Nov. 10 vs. SJ (Vernon) ... posted a point in back-to-back games (Nov. 6 & 10) ...recorded his first <strong>NHL</strong> career point on Nov. 6 vs. FLA (assist) ... played his first <strong>NHL</strong> career game on Oct. 28 at OTT going +1 ... recorded 10 points (3g, 7a)at home and two goals on the road … averaged 18:24 minutes of ice-time … recalled from Saint John on Oct. 28 ... made his professional debut playingin five games with the Saint John Flames of the American Hockey League … was assigned to Saint John on a two-week conditioning assignment on Oct.14 following rehabilitation of leg injuries suffered in a car accident in JulyINTERNATIONAL HIGHLIGHTS2006 – posted one assist at the 2006 Winter Olympics … 2005 – won a silver medal with Canada at the World Championships … 2004 – played withteammate Jarome Iginla on the championship winning Team Canada at the World Cup of Hockey … 2000 - was a member of Team Canada at the 2000World ChampionshipsJUNIOR HIGHLIGHTSPlayed three seasons with Kamloops of the Western Hockey League (WHL) … in 183 games with Kamloops, Regehr collected 69 points (20 goals, 49assists) and 346 penalty minutes… 1998-99 – played on the WHL finalist Kamloops Blazers recording 32 points (12g, 20a) in 54 regular season games andfive points (1g, 4a) in 12 post season games … named to WHL West First All-Star Team … 1997-98 – played his second season with the Blazers posting14 points in 65 games … 1996-97 – played in his rookie season in the WHL posting 23 points (4g, 19a) in 64 games with Kamloops88 CALGARY FLAMES
